“Wolf of Wall Street” Jordan Belfort Faces New Lawsuit

Jordan Belfort, the by now larger than life stockbroker portrayed in the immediate classic ‘Wolf of Wall Street’ is facing fresh court calls as a federal judge claims he will need to testify about his current income, given that Mr. Belfort still owes some $97 million in unpaid restitution.

Brooklyn federal Judge Ann Donnelly stated: “I do want to figure out a way to make a bigger dent in what he owes.”

“It’s not a particularly attractive picture, him taking all this money and claiming he needs it to support his family.”

As many of those who’ve seen the movie know, Mr. Belfort served 22 months in federal prison between the years 2004 and 2006 for securities fraud which totaled some $200 million.

Judges at the time ordered Mr. Belfort to pay back some $110 million of that money, but according to recent court records, he has made considerable amounts from speeches and book sales between 2013 and 2015 of which he kept some $9 million.

Ms. Donnelly: “It seems like he has some spare change lying around.”

“He’s going to have to come here so we can get a grip on what’s going on.”

Mr. Belfort’s lawyer, Ms. Sharon Cohen Levin stated that the former stockbroker is “actually is quite cash-strapped, right now.”
